Is there a market for plus-sized menswear?

Image: Parker & Pine

Business of Fashion takes an interesting look at the plus-sized market, looking at whether there are opportunities for menswear.

Of course, like womenswear, it's not as easy as just bolting on extra inches to your standard patterns. Brands need to truly understand the differences in larger bodies and making these subtle alternations in the form of plus-sized clothes. And then there is the matter of cost, because extra raw material simply costs more. These are all considerations for brands wanting to venture into the plus-sized market, but there is also huge opportunity within the menswear sector. In 2014, Mintel reported that the menswear markert has grown 18% in the last five years.
